Since Amplify damage removes " immunite to physical damage" from stoneskin elites, u can solo every instance with ease. Heres my build: 20 to skeletons, 20 to skeleton mastery, 20 to clay golems, 20 to golem mastery and all the rest points to Amplify damage. If your Filthy rich, you can add BEAST runeword for your mercenary to even more boost your MF capability. Important here is to understand that you need a A5 Mercenary with MIGHT aura. I can solo every basic instance diablo, baal, cows you name it( not including Ubers n Dclones) with just +6 to summoning skills in full MF gear on with +650 MF rating with this easy setup. Forget the mages, forget fire golem, forget corpe explosion. In PD2 the way to go as summonecro is to go for melee attacks, meaning forget about any elemental damage u can get.
